Description[?]:
The following Amendment, if adopted, would legally ensure that no person shall serve in the office of the presidency (Head of State) for more than two terms. (A term of office being at the point in time of the adoption of this amendment being a 4 year period and "two terms" being the equivalent of 8 years.) |
